Chapter 54: Man-made filaments
Use HS-4 5403 when importing artificial filament yarns that are not sold in retail packaging, such as high tenacity viscose rayon monofilaments. For example, if you’re importing a bulk shipment of monofilament yarn for industrial use, this heading is applicable.
When deciding among the HS-6 subheadings, consider the material and twist of the yarn. For instance, 540310 is specifically for high tenacity viscose rayon, while 540331 and 540332 cover untwisted and twisted viscose rayon yarns, respectively. The twist level is crucial for classification.
If your product is made from cellulose acetate, you will look at 540333 for single yarns or 540342 for multiple (folded) yarns. The distinction between single and multiple yarns is important for proper classification under this heading.
